Jimmy Fallon's Network: NBCUniversal, Streaming, and Revenue Facts

Comcast Corporation reports NBCUniversal as a single segment in its financial filings. NBCUniversal's revenue includes media networks, filmed entertainment, parks, and streaming. The Tonight Show generates revenue through advertising sales, affiliate fees, and brand integrations. Fallon's role as host aligns with NBCUniversal's strategy to retain late-night viewers across linear and digital platforms. Comcast official site publishes segment financials.

Streaming and Digital Distribution

NBCUniversal content, including Tonight Show clips, streams on Peacock, the company's direct-to-consumer platform. Peacock offers ad-supported and premium tiers that distribute late-night segments to on-demand audiences. The Tonight Show also distributes clips through YouTube, social platforms, and partner sites, extending reach beyond linear television. Peacock official site details streaming plans.

Digital distribution supports audience growth metrics that advertisers evaluate when buying late-night inventory. NBCUniversal tracks cross-platform views, completion rates, and demographic data for Fallon's segments. These metrics influence ad pricing and sponsorship deals tied to The Tonight Show and related NBCUniversal properties. NBC official site provides show information.

Revenue, Ratings, and Financial Impact

The Tonight Show contributes to NBCUniversal's media networks revenue through advertising and affiliate fees. Late-night advertising rates depend on ratings, demographics, and time slot performance. Fallon's tenure has maintained stable late-night viewership for NBC, supporting premium ad pricing during broadcasts and digital extensions.

Advertising and Sponsorship

Brands sponsor segments, digital integrations, and cross-platform campaigns around The Tonight Show. Fallon's broad audience appeal makes the show a vehicle for consumer product launches and promotional partnerships. NBCUniversal monetizes these opportunities through direct sales and programmatic advertising across its portfolio.

Financial Reporting and Public Data

Comcast discloses NBCUniversal financials in quarterly and annual reports. Investors analyze late-night entertainment as part of the media networks segment, alongside cable networks and broadcast revenue. Public filings provide data on advertising trends, subscriber metrics, and content investments that affect Fallon's show.
